Output 0661614565da1f131d3cca6cb5fa771f5b1ad508d4e17deffbf22fa1236bd923:0

value
24990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e8b696fa7403583350c6e22bcbd98f827e3c112 OP_EQUALVERIFY OP_CHECKSIG
address
19cuXYCWaEnAGK1AtwxQ77uq7NE3DhRCVG
transaction
0661614565da1f131d3cca6cb5fa771f5b1ad508d4e17deffbf22fa1236bd923
confirmations
310412
spent
true